I use SVN, and when I started my project even though the bin folder was marked to be ignored by SVN, it would always want to submit my src/ files into the bin directory, which made no sense. After some searching, I found out that the Eclise build process was copying the .svn folder from the src/ folder to the bin/ folder, making SVN think they were pointing to the same folder in the repository. To fix it I added the .svn/ folders to the exclude path of the project build properties.
